Processing Your Claim After an Accident
After being involved in an accident, the primary step is to communicate with your insurance company. It's important to report the accident as soon as possible. When presenting your claim, be detailed and give all required information.
This includes details about the accident itself, including the date, time, location, concerning parties, and losses. It's also crucial to gather evidence such as photos, police reports, and observer statements.
Keep all documentation related to the accident, including medical records, repair estimates, and correspondence with your insurance firm. Be patient as the claims process can take some time.
Common Mistakes to Avoid in Accident Insurance Claims
Filing an accident insurance claim can feel overwhelming. Numerous people make mistakes that could potentially delay the settlement. To guarantee a read more smooth experience, avoid of these common pitfalls:
* Failing to report your claim promptly. Time is of the essence when it comes to insurance claims.
* Providing inaccurate or incomplete information. Double-check all details before submitting your claim.
* Withholding important facts. Be transparent with your insurer to avoid subsequent complications.
* Overstating your injuries or damages.
* Providing false statements intentionally. This is a serious offense that can lead to claim denial and legal consequences.
By avoiding these common mistakes, you can strengthen your chances of a successful accident insurance claim.
Significance of Documentation in Accident Insurance Cases
Documentation plays a fundamental role in accident insurance cases. Thorough and accurate records can significantly influence the outcome of your claim. They provide concrete support to substantiate your injuries, expenses, and lost income. Gathering detailed documentation from various sources, such as medical records, police reports, and witness statements, helps establish a convincing narrative of the accident and its consequences on your life. Insurance providers rely heavily on documentation to assess the validity and severity of claims, so it's crucial to provide as much pertinent information as possible.
